一种移动终端的开发环境维护方法及装置制造方法及图纸

技术编号:24937571 阅读:18 留言:0更新日期:2020-07-17 20:51
本发明专利技术的实施例公开一种移动终端的开发环境维护方法、装置、电子设备及存储介质,涉及计算机技术领域,能够有效提高应用程序开发的操作效率。所述方法包括:通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态;其中,所述移动终端的操作系统包括多种终端操作系统;通过可视化界面展示所述连接状态。本发明专利技术适用于移动终端的开发调试中。

【技术实现步骤摘要】
一种移动终端的开发环境维护方法及装置
本专利技术涉及计算机
,尤其涉及一种移动终端的开发环境维护方法及装置。
技术介绍
移动终端的应用程序在开发时,一般需要将移动终端与计算机连接,使计算机中的开发环境能够与移动终端的操作系统进行有效通信。将移动终端插入计算机后,为了获知开发环境是否已经与移动终端的操作系统进行有效连接,开发者一般需要输入相应的查询命令。例如,对于Android系统的移动终端,需要开发者手动输入adbdevices或adbdevices-1命令后查看移动终端的连接信息,才可确认是否连接成功,大大降低了开发的操作效率。
技术实现思路
有鉴于此,本专利技术实施例提供一种移动终端的开发环境维护方法、装置、电子设备及存储介质,能够有效提高应用程序开发的操作效率。第一方面,本专利技术实施例提供一种移动终端的开发环境维护方法,包括:通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态;其中,所述移动终端的操作系统包括多种终端操作系统;通过可视化界面展示所述连接状态。可选的,所述查询所述移动终端的操作系统的连接状态包括:每间隔预设时长查询一次所述移动终端的操作系统的连接状态。可选的,所述移动终端的操作系统包括以下至少一种:Android系统、ios系统、Windows系统。可选的,所述移动终端的操作系统为所述Android系统;所述查询所述移动终端的操作系统的连接状态包括:通过调用adb工具查询所述移动终端的操作系统的连接状态。可选的,所述通过调用adb工具查询所述移动终端的操作系统的连接状态包括:获取本地adb工具的安装路径;根据所述安装路径激活所述adb工具;指示所述adb工具与所述移动终端的adb应用进行交互通信;根据所述移动终端的adb应用的反馈,确定所述移动终端的操作系统的连接状态。可选的,所述获取本地adb工具的安装路径包括:通过搜索adb工具的名称,获取所述adb工具的安装路径。可选的,在通过搜索adb工具的名称,获取所述adb工具的安装路径之后,所述方法还包括:将获取的所述adb工具的安装路径保存在预设文件中,以便将来通过访问所述预设文件获取所述安装路径。可选的,所述可视化界面包括以下至少一种:基于MAC操作系统的可视化界面、Windows操作系统的可视化界面、Linux操作系统的可视化界面。第二方面,本专利技术的实施例还提供一种移动终端的开发环境维护装置,包括:查询单元,用于通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态;其中,所述移动终端的操作系统包括多种终端操作系统;展示单元,用于通过可视化界面展示所述连接状态。可选的,所述查询单元,具体用于每间隔预设时长查询一次所述移动终端的操作系统的连接状态。可选的,所述移动终端的操作系统包括以下至少一种:Android系统、ios系统、Windows系统。可选的,所述移动终端的操作系统为所述Android系统;所述查询单元,具体用于通过调用adb工具查询所述移动终端的操作系统的连接状态。可选的,所述查询单元包括:获取模块,用于获取本地adb工具的安装路径;激活模块,用于根据所述安装路径激活所述adb工具;指示模块,用于指示所述adb工具与所述移动终端的adb应用进行交互通信;确定模块,用于根据所述移动终端的adb应用的反馈,确定所述移动终端的操作系统的连接状态。可选的,所述获取模块,具体用于通过搜索adb工具的名称,获取所述adb工具的安装路径。可选的,所述获取模块,还用于在通过搜索adb工具的名称,获取所述adb工具的安装路径之后,将获取的所述adb工具的安装路径保存在预设文件中,以便将来通过访问所述预设文件获取所述安装路径。可选的,所述可视化界面包括以下至少一种:基于MAC操作系统的可视化界面、Windows操作系统的可视化界面、Linux操作系统的可视化界面。第三方面,本专利技术的实施例还提供一种电子设备,所述电子设备包括:壳体、处理器、存储器、电路板和电源电路,其中,电路板安置在壳体围成的空间内部,处理器和存储器设置在电路板上;电源电路,用于为上述电子设备的各个电路或器件供电;存储器用于存储可执行程序代码;处理器通过读取存储器中存储的可执行程序代码来运行与可执行程序代码对应的程序,用于执行本专利技术的实施例提供的任一种移动终端的开发环境维护方法。第四方面,本专利技术的实施例还提供一种计算机可读存储介质,所述计算机可读存储介质存储有一个或者多个程序,所述一个或者多个程序可被一个或者多个处理器执行,以实现本专利技术的实施例提供的任一种移动终端的开发环境维护方法。本专利技术的实施例提供的移动终端的开发环境维护方法、装置、电子设备及存储介质,计算机能够在通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态,并通过可视化界面展示所述连接状态。这样,用户无需任何操作,即可随时获知计算机与移动终端的多种终端操作系统之间是否已经连接上,或是否已经断开,以便基于多种终端操作系统顺利进行移动终端的应用程序开发,有效提高了应用程序开发的操作效率。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其它的附图。图1为本专利技术的实施例提供的移动终端的开发环境维护方法的一种流程图;图2为本专利技术的实施例提供的移动终端的开发环境维护方法中可视化界面的一种结构示意图;图3为本专利技术的实施例提供的移动终端的开发环境维护方法的一种详细流程图;图4为本专利技术的实施例提供的移动终端的开发环境维护装置的一种结构示意图;图5为本专利技术的实施例提供的电子设备的一种结构示意图。具体实施方式下面结合附图对本专利技术实施例进行详细描述。应当明确,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其它实施例,都属于本专利技术保护的范围。对移动终端上的应用程序进行开发时,一般需要在计算机上建立移动终端的开发环境,在该开发环境中编写源代码、并根据源代码生成应用文件。在进行程序开发时,常常需要将移动终端与计算机相连,以便进行通信。然而,由于需要对移动终端中的应用程序进行开发,需要计算机中的开发环境与移动终端的操作系统之间建立连接,移动终端与计算机的连接状态虽然能够通过USB端口或WiFi信号的连接状态获知,但移动终端与计算机的连接状态并不能代表计算机中的开发环境与移动终端的操作系统之间的连接状态。为了能够让用户及时获知计算机中的开发环境与移动终端的操作系统之间的连接状态,以便提高应用程序开发的操作效率,本专利技术的实施例提供一种移动终端的开发环境维护方法、装置、电子设本文档来自技高网...

【技术保护点】
1.一种移动终端的开发环境维护方法,其特征在于,包括:/n通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态;其中,所述移动终端的操作系统包括多种终端操作系统;/n通过可视化界面展示所述连接状态。/n

【技术特征摘要】
1.一种移动终端的开发环境维护方法,其特征在于,包括:
通过预设通信端口接入移动终端后,查询所述移动终端的操作系统的连接状态;其中,所述移动终端的操作系统包括多种终端操作系统;
通过可视化界面展示所述连接状态。


2.根据权利要求1所述的方法,其特征在于,所述查询所述移动终端的操作系统的连接状态包括:
每间隔预设时长查询一次所述移动终端的操作系统的连接状态。


3.根据权利要求1所述的方法,其特征在于,所述移动终端的操作系统包括以下至少一种:Android系统、ios系统、Windows系统。


4.根据权利要求3所述的方法,其特征在于,所述移动终端的操作系统为所述Android系统;
所述查询所述移动终端的操作系统的连接状态包括:
通过调用安卓调试桥adb工具查询所述移动终端的操作系统的连接状态。


5.根据权利要求4所述的方法,其特征在于,所述通过调用安卓调试桥adb工具查询所述移动终端的操作系统的连接状态包括:
获取本地adb工具的安装路径;
根据所述安装路径激活所述adb工具;
指示所述adb工具与所述移动终端的adb应用进行交互通信;
根据所述移动...

【专利技术属性】
技术研发人员:王鹏
申请(专利权)人:香港乐蜜有限公司
类型:发明
国别省市:中国香港;81

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1